DocumentCode :
322506
Title :
On relating blackboards in the μLog coordination model
Author :
Jacquet, Jean-Marie ; De Bosschere, Koen
Author_Institution :
Univ. of Namur, Belgium
Volume :
1
fYear :
1997
fDate :
7-10 Jan 1997
Firstpage :
359
Abstract :
We describe coordination relations, that are relations that induce the presence of data on some data spaces from the presence of other data on other data spaces. To that end we build upon previous work on the μLog model and show that the coordination relations can be easily incorporated in it. Part of this incorporation is achieved through the use of multiple blackboards and processes running on them. The remaining effort is achieved by means of auxiliary operators involving multiple conditional read operations. Although simple, the form of coordination relations we propose are quite powerful as evidenced by a few examples including relations coming from the object-oriented paradigm such as data space inheritance, merge and relations involving constraints
Keywords :
inheritance; merging; object-oriented programming; parallel languages; parallel programming; programming theory; μLog coordination model; auxiliary operators; constraints; coordination languages; coordination relations; data spaces; inheritance; merging; multiple blackboards; multiple conditional read operations; object-oriented paradigm; Application software; Context modeling; Information systems; Java; Logic programming; Merging; Object oriented modeling; Open systems; Programming profession; Software maintenance; Software tools;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
System Sciences, 1997, Proceedings of the Thirtieth Hawaii International Conference on
Conference_Location :
Wailea, HI
ISSN :
1060-3425
Print_ISBN :
0-8186-7743-0
Type :
conf
DOI :
10.1109/HICSS.1997.667283
Filename :
667283
Link To Document :
بازگشت